The history of Oanda Corporation began in 1996 when Dr. Michael Stumm and Dr. Richard Olsen decided that internet trading should be accessible to everyone. Initially, Oanda Corporation promoted applied ASP services, but since 2001, it has shifted to providing brokerage services.

Today, the broker has seven major centres and clients in nearly two hundred countries. Oanda's clients can trade currencies, indices, commodities, and precious metals.

Regulation in Australia

OANDA Australia Pty Ltd operates under the strict regulatory oversight of the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C), ensuring a high level of protection for traders. ASIC's regulatory framework is designed to maintain the integrity of financial markets and protect consumer interests. In Australia, OANDA clients benefit from the ASIC's mandate for fair and transparent trading practices. Additionally, while Australia does not have a formal investor compensation scheme like some other countries, ASIC's stringent capital requirements and compliance standards provide investors with a significant layer of safety. Traders with OANDA Australia are also protected by the firm's adherence to ASIC's rules regarding client money, which require brokers to keep client funds separate from the company's funds in segregated accounts. This ensures client assets are protected in the unlikely event of the broker's insolvency.

Registration

Registering for an account with Oanda involves providing detailed personal and financial information to ensure compliance with regulatory standards and to tailor the trading experience to your needs.

To open an account, you must provide the following information:

  1. Personal and Contact Information: You will need to provide your name, address, and date of birth. This basic information is essential for setting up your profile.

  2. Identification Details: For identity verification, Oanda requires details from your driver's license. This step is crucial for confirming your identity and complying with legal requirements.

  3. Financial Information and Trading Experience: You will be asked to provide information about your financial status and previous trading experience. This helps Oanda assess the types of trading activities that are suitable for you.

  4. Client Suitability Assessment: Part of the registration process includes an assessment to determine if trading is suitable for you, based on your experience, financial status, and trading objectives.

Oanda will attempt to verify your identity electronically (EID) by matching the details provided during registration with those in your credit file. Note that this process does not involve checking your credit score.

Even if you pass the EID process, stay alert for any communication from Oanda’s Onboarding team. They may contact you to confirm or clarify the details of your application.

Professional Trading Account

Oanda offers a Professional Trading Account tailored for experienced traders seeking enhanced features. This account type provides increased leverage options and a range of exclusive benefits.

Key Features and Offers

  1. Higher leverage ratios: Trade Forex and CFDs with increased leverage.
  2. Volume rebates and margin relief: Available when placing guaranteed stop-loss orders (GSLO), stop-loss orders, or trailing stop losses on indices, forex, gold, silver, and crude oil CFD trades.
  3. Cash rebates: Up to US$7 per million for a limited time. Minimum trade volumes apply.
  4. Welcome bonus: New account holders can receive up to AU$10,000 based on initial deposit and trading requirements within 90 days.

Account Comparison

FeatureRetail AccountProfessional Account
Available LeverageFrom 30:1From 100:1
Margin Relief on SLOs/GSLOsNoYes
Client Funds SegregationYesYes
Volume RebatesNoYes
Margin Closeout Level50%50%
Negative Balance ProtectionYesNo
Access to FSGYesNo
Access to PDSYesNo
Compensation & Dispute ResolutionYesAt AFCA's discretion

Qualification Criteria

  • Wholesale clients: Assets of at least AU$2.5 million, gross income of at least AU$250,000 for the last 2 financial years, plus certification from a qualified accountant and high financial literacy.
  • Sophisticated investors: At least 12 months of trading experience, 150 derivatives trades in the last 12 months, a total notional value of trades equal to or greater than US$10 million, and satisfactory assessment by an OANDA representative.

Commission per lot

In the Core Pricing account, Oanda charges a commission of $3.5 per lot for one-sided trades. This rate is considered average in the market, balancing competitive pricing with the services provided.

Inactivity Fee

The broker charges an inactivity fee if no trading activity has occurred on an account for 12 months.

The fee is 10 AUD. The inactivity fee stops being charged if:

  • there are no funds left in the account;
  • the account has been closed;
  • the client has resumed trading activities.

If a client resumes trading, they may request a refund of the inactivity fees charged for up to three months.

OANDA Trade

OANDA Trade is an Android and iOS mobile application recognised for its high-quality technology, speed, and reliability.

The app allows you to access all your accounts using a single-tap login feature, eliminating the need to sign in repeatedly.

After installing the app, press the "One-Tap Sign-In" button and enter your standard OANDA credentials. This redirects you to a page displaying all your accounts.

Starting trading in the OANDA Trade app is straightforward and user-friendly. You can browse numerous available instruments and look for the most likely trades. Setting risk and profit parameters is quickly done in the order terminal, and you can monitor the chart even while placing your trade.

Integration with TradingView

TradingView is a popular social trading platform that allows traders to view thousands of charts, analyze market trends, and share ideas with other users worldwide. It is a meeting place for traders and investors to exchange opinions and trading ideas in real time.

A key feature of TradingView is the large array of technical analysis tools and indicators that can be used to create complex trading strategies. The platform supports trading across various financial markets, including Forex, stocks, indices, futures, and cryptocurrencies.

Technical Analysis on TradingView
Technical Analysis on TradingView

Oanda's integration with TradingView allows traders to leverage the benefits of this platform, including the ability to trade directly from TradingView charts. This means traders can access deep market analysis, extensive graphic analysis tools, and a community of traders without leaving the Oanda platform.

Currency Correlation Table

Oanda offers a currency correlation table, enabling a quick assessment of the relationships between various currency pairs. The correlation coefficients in the table help determine the degree of correlation between two currency pairs.
